Tender description

The Contracting Authority is setting up a panel of suppliers to supply materials needs for the conservation, archiving, transport and storage of museum collections. The Contracting Authority do not expect any one supplier to be able to provide the full range of materials needed for this, and hope to reflect the diverse needs of museum, library and archive collections through a panel of suppliers with various skills and specialities. On this panel, the Contracting Authority invites suppliers who offers a wide range of packing, wrapping, storage, stabilisation and transport materials to conservation and archival standard. This material is for all aspects of museum collections care and management, include all object, artefact, specimen, archive and library collections. There may be a requirement for some made to order materials, e.g. conservation-grade, acid-free boxes made to specific sizes. All supplies must be conservation grade for the safe care and long-term storage of museum objects. In so far as possible, supplies should be made from sustainable materials and an energy-efficient manner. The Contracting Authority strongly encourages both large supplies and small, specialist suppliers to register for this panel, as there are many specific materials needed in museum collections management that are difficult to find and often only produced by smaller, specialist companies. The Contracting Authority also invites suppliers who have museum, library and archival-relevant materials not listed below to come forward and register for this panel. A list of materials is included in the Request to Participate in the Panel document and includes, inter alia: - Boxes and box-making equipment - Packing and wrapping materials - Labelling - Conservation Supplies - General Equipment - PPE - Disaster and Risk Management supplies
